마우스로 객체 드래그(레이어 이동창)

<style>
.drag { position: relative; cursor:move }
</style>
<script>
//------------ 마우스로 객체 드래그
var bdown = false;
var x, y;
var sElem;

function mdown() {
if(event.srcElement.className == "drag") {
bdown = true;
sElem = event.srcElement;
x = event.clientX;
y = event.clientY;
}
}
function mup() {
bdown = false;
}
function moveimg() {
if(bdown) {
var distX = event.clientX - x;
var distY = event.clientY - y;
sElem.style.pixelLeft += distX;
sElem.style.pixelTop += distY;
x = event.clientX;
y = event.clientY;
return false;
}
}
document.onmousedown = mdown;
document.onmouseup = mup;
document.onmousemove = moveimg;
</script>
댓글
  • No Nickname
    No Comment
  • 권한이 없습니다.
    {{m_row.m_nick}}
    -